2012-03-28 14 views
6

ओएस: मिंट लिनक्स 11 64 बिटआरवीएम और मणि के साथ कंपास कैसे स्थापित करें और चलाएं?

मुझे रूबी के बारे में कुछ नहीं पता, मैं बस कम्पास चाहता हूं।

मैं rvm और गहरे लाल रंग का 1.9.3 स्थापित किया है, और मणि

$ gem list 

*** LOCAL GEMS *** 

bundler (1.1.3) 
chunky_png (1.2.5) 
compass (0.12.1) 
fssm (0.2.8.1) 
rake (0.9.2) 
rubygems-bundler (0.2.8) 
sass (3.1.15) 

के माध्यम से डिफ़ॉल्ट माणिक कम्पास सेट

$ rvm list 

rvm rubies 

=* ruby-1.9.3-p125 [ x86_64 ] 

# => - current 
# =* - current && default 
# * - default 

मैं स्थापित किया है लेकिन मैं कम्पास नहीं चलाया जा सकता, क्योंकि मणि/बिन $ PATH

में मैंने इसे $ PATH में जोड़ा और फिर कंपास चलाया:

$ compass 
/home/il/.rvm/rubies/ruby-1.9.3-p125/lib/ruby/site_ruby/1.9.1/rubygems/dependency.rb:247:in `to_specs': Could not find compass (>= 0) amongst [bigdecimal-1.1.0, io-console-0.3, json-1.5.4, minitest-2.5.1, rake-0.9.2.2, rdoc-3.9.4] (Gem::LoadError) 
from /home/il/.rvm/rubies/ruby-1.9.3-p125/lib/ruby/site_ruby/1.9.1/rubygems/dependency.rb:256:in `to_spec' 
from /home/il/.rvm/rubies/ruby-1.9.3-p125/lib/ruby/site_ruby/1.9.1/rubygems.rb:1230:in `gem' 
from /home/il/.rvm/gems/ruby-1.9.3-p125/bin/compass:18:in `<main>' 

क्या कोई मदद कर सकता है?

+0

क्या आप कृपया समझा सकते हैं कि आपने अपना कंपास प्रोजेक्ट कैसे चलाया है? जब मैं कंपास कमांड चलाने की कोशिश करता हूं तो यह मुझे कंपास सहायता दिखाता है .. – tokhi

उत्तर

13

$ rvm wrapper [email protected] --no-prefix compass

+0

धन्यवाद लोहे की रोशनी, यह काम किया! रूबी के साथ काम करने वाले लोग आरएमवी रत्नों के बारे में पढ़ना चाहते हैं https://rvm.io/gemsets/, आपको –

11

कि rvm संभालने स्थापित किया गया है आप की तरह कुछ कर सकता है:

$ rvm install 2.1.1 
$ rvm @global do gem install compass 

sudo करने के लिए कोई ज़रूरत नहीं।

+0

धन्यवाद से बचने के लिए सबसे अच्छा अभ्यास के रूप में उपयोग करना चाहिए! जिसने मेरी समस्या तय की – Maksym

संबंधित मुद्दे